Analysis

Eswatini recorded 98.1% for share of urban population using at least basic water services in 2024. That is the highest value across all 25 years on record.

The figure is up 0.4% on the previous year and up 4.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of urban population using at least basic water services in Eswatini peaked at 98.1%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 87.7%, in 2000.

That places Eswatini 97th out of 188 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 25 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
2000s 89.7% 87.7% 91.6% 10
2010s 94.0% 92.0% 96.0% 10
2020s 97.3% 96.4% 98.1% 5
